In India, rural incomes are generally lower than the urban incomes. Which of the following reasons account for his?

  1. A large number of farmers are illiterate and know little about scientific agriculture

  2. Prices of primary products are lower than of manufactured products

  3. Investment in agriculture has been low when compared to investment in industry

Select the correct answer by using the codes given below:

Codes:

(a) 1, 2 and 3 (b) 1 and 3 (c) 1 and 3 (d) 2 and 3

(d) Prevailing illiteracy in rural areas is low but it does not lower productivity. The farmer has adequate knowledge of farming techniques. Low prices of primary products compared to the manufactured products and investment in the agriculture sector compared to the industry are major factors which accounts for low incomes in rural economy than in Urban economy
